Sherman Branch Nature Preserve is a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ts, offering a variety of trails perfect for hiking and mountain biking just outside of Charlotte, North Carolina.

As you navigate the pathways, practical preparations are essential for maximizing enjoyment and safety. Sturdy hiking shoes or boots are highly recommended to tackle the gentle inclines and occasional rocky stretches with confidence. Carry sufficient water—at least two liters is ideal—as well as some healthy snacks to keep your energy levels buoyant. Plan to start your hike in the early morning or late afternoon to avoid the midday sun, allowing you to appreciate the changing hues of the landscape as the day unfolds.

Entrance Requirements

Free access, no permits required

Best Time to Visit

Spring and Fall for pleasant temperatures and vibrant foliage

Visitor Information

No formal visitor center; informational kiosks at trailheads

Getting There

Accessible via local roads; no seasonal closures

Weather & Climate

Experience mild winters and warm, humid summers. Spring and fall present the most comfortable conditions for outdoor activities, with temperatures typically ranging from 50°F to 75°F.

Conservation Efforts

The preserve faces challenges from urban encroachment. Efforts are in place to maintain the balance between recreational use and habitat protection for wildlife.

Trailblazer Tips

Mountain bikers should try the Roller Coaster trail for an exhilarating ride.

Spring and fall offer the best weather and scenery for visiting.

Parking can fill up quickly on weekends, so early arrival is recommended.

Carry insect repellent, especially in warmer months, to ward off mosquitos.
